Alfie Major

Alfie Major

2025Jul03 ADC United Kingdom ADC United Kingdom

Vault 13.0 @ The Cue and Arrow, Leighton Buzzard (Thursdays)

  • Result: Group Stage
  • 51.05
  • 58.64

The Cue and Arrow
6 Dudley St, Leighton Buzzard LU7 1SE


You have a new competition invitation

Check It Out

You have a new friend invitation

Check It Out

You have a new practice game invitation

Check It Out